
Performing Artists
Performing artists are individuals who entertain and engage audiences through live presentations, such as music, theater, dance, or comedy. They use their skills and creativity in front of an audience to communicate stories, emotions, or ideas, often requiring extensive training and dedication. Their work can take place on stages, in venues, or through digital platforms, and they often collaborate with directors, choreographers, or other artists to produce compelling performances. Performing artists contribute to cultural expression and entertainment, enriching our social and artistic experiences.
